Output 34cc9c3b40c86ac9195dcba62e22ab2e56d99b0e30c72b72c13fe2c99ecad807:9

value
267871
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8940476762dc3f6b88ca3811ddfe330dcc6f9e8e OP_EQUAL
address
3ECjW15teNMKpizSfBjhrje2cVMmFDmEcv
transaction
34cc9c3b40c86ac9195dcba62e22ab2e56d99b0e30c72b72c13fe2c99ecad807
spent
true